Output 456efc91ea52c573940b55ed90291306d34656eab243fdb67d5cbae84a248730:10

value
135066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e161dc897cbfab00a0c1ae7af98d00c0c9859375 OP_EQUAL
address
3NEjCEsQXausm8UcocbittzH2D7qrnep8p
transaction
456efc91ea52c573940b55ed90291306d34656eab243fdb67d5cbae84a248730
spent
true